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Westerton to Chorley start from as little as £14.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Westerton to Chorley start from £68.70 one way, or £98.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Westerton to Chorley are available for £71.80 one way, or £143.60 return

Facilities and Services at Westerton Station

Westerton is equipped with essential amenities to enhance your travel experience. The ticket office is operational from 6:30 am to 20:50 on weekdays and Saturdays, and a bit shorter on Sundays opening from 9:10 am to 16:50. Ticket machines are accessible, allowing you to collect tickets bought online. The station supports smartcard validators for easy check-in and check-out.

For those requiring additional assistance, Westerton caters with step-free access throughout its premises, making it an accessible Category A station. Passengers can use ramps for a seamless journey to and from trains. Help points are available for customer assistance, making sure everyone feels supported.

While the station might lack some amenities like cafes, shops, and ATM machines, it compensates with free parking space available 24/7, and secure bicycle storage with 12 stands. Remember, if you need to use the toilets, they are open upon request during the ticket office’s operating hours.

Getting Around Westerton: Useful Transport Links

Navigating onward from Westerton is straightforward with various options available. For those needing a rail replacement service, buses can be found at the Maxwell Avenue station car park turning circle. Taxis can be booked via train taxi service, providing a convenient onward journey.

If buses are your preference, visit Travel Line Scotland or call their 24-hour line at 0871 200 22 33 for service details. These options ensure you're connected to your next destination with ease.

Facilities and Accessibility at Chorley Station

Chorley Station ensures a seamless ticketing experience with its easily accessible ticket office and machines. The ticket office operates from 06:25 to early evenings on weekdays and extends later into the evening on Saturdays, ensuring ample time for ticket purchases. For those who prefer digital convenience, smartcards are issued at the station, accompanied by validators for a swift and hassle-free check-in.

Your safety and comfort are paramount, with the station being equipped with CCTV. Although there are no waiting areas or first-class lounges, seating is available for your convenience. It's worth noting that while the station is fully equipped with steps and ramps for step-free access, it does fall short in terms of some accessible facilities such as accessible toilets and waiting rooms.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Chorley Station is fantastically connected to various transport modes. If your journey involves buses, the nearby bus interchange on Shepherd’s Way caters to connections for routes towards Bolton and Preston. Additionally, for those looking to conveniently book a cab, resources such as the [Cab4You service](https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you) offer easy online taxi reservations.

Although bicycle hire isn't available directly at the station, the local vicinity provides opportunities for cycling enthusiasts to explore further.
